Little Black Book | |
|
Friday 20th Aug 2010 |
Chicago photographer Kelli Taylor just finished this “Little Black Book” bridal shower recipe book for one of her good friends, Ali. Ali, bride-to-be, yoga instructor and nutritionist, is marrying a man that cannot survive for the rest of his life on only fiber. For his sake, I collected everyone’s favorite homemade recipe and brought them together into a recipe-themed book filled with her closest friend’s past memories and future wishes. Each spread of the black Cortina Lux scrapbook is dedicated to one of the shower’s attendees. On the left side of the spread, Kelli features a Q&A about their relationship with the bride. The right side highlights the person’s favorite recipe securely tucked into a decorative envelope. I wanted it to be functional without sacrificing the look of the book. Instead of carting a book cloth album into the kitchen, I designed it so the recipe cards were removable. I typed each recipe on an individual card, attached a string and slid it into a custom made envelope. Thank you to always-creative Kelli for sharing another great project! Visit Kelli’s site, here. “A Modern Look at Old Tustin” | |
|
Wednesday 18th Aug 2010 |
California photographer and artist Emet Martinez created this collection of books for the Tustin Area Council for Fine Arts, an organization dedicated to advancing the study of arts through the support of local artists. The collection is entitled “A Modern Look at Old Tustin,” visually documenting the city using his own photographic style. The goal of the project was to document Old Tustin’s architecture, greeneries, open spaces and sceneries at different times of the day through a modern photographer’s eye. I used a contemporary approach using selective focusing, creative angles and the use of watercolor filter to create unique images that are modern in terms of image capture style but traditional in terms of look and feel through the watercolor effect.
